基于最小方差基准的悬浮控制系统性能评估试验研究  

Experimental study on performance evaluation of suspension control system based on minimum variance benchmark

摘  要:轨道不平顺是磁浮列车悬浮系统的主要激扰源,直接影响悬浮的稳定性、列车运行的安全性和舒适性。性能良好的悬浮控制系统应对轨道不平顺、车轨耦合振动等,具有良好的抵抗能力。衡量系统抵抗不确定性扰动能力,通常采用随机性性能评价指标,一般以最小方差指标为主。文章通过单点悬浮系统模型,仿真分析了最小方差评价指标在悬浮系统性能评价中的适用性。依托长沙EMS型中低速磁浮快线,通过列车搭载的悬浮数据采集系统,获得实车运行悬浮间隙数据,开展基于最小方差基准的悬浮控制系统性能评估。结果表明,最小方差指标可以较好地反映悬浮控制系统的运行性能,通过性能指标的变化可以及时发现列车运行线路中存在的轨道不平顺等故障隐患。Track irregularities are a primary source of disturbance to the suspension system of maglev trains,directly affecting sus-pension stability,operational safety,and riding comfort.High-performance suspension control systems exhibit effective resistance to track irregularities and vehicle-track coupling vibrations.Stochastic performance evaluation indexes are typically used to measure the system’s ability to resist uncertain disturbance,with the minimum variance index being the most commonly used.In this study,the appli-cability of the minimum variance evaluation index for evaluating the performance of suspension systems was analyzed through simula-tions based on a single-point suspension system model.Relying on the medium-low speed line of Changsha maglev express based on electromagnetic suspension(EMS),suspension gap data was collected during real train operation via an on-board suspension data acqui-sition system.This data was then used to conduct a performance evaluation of suspension control systems based on the minimum vari-ance benchmark.The results show that the minimum variance index plays a relatively effective role in reflecting the operating perfor-mance of suspension control systems.Additionally,hidden troubles such as track irregularities are identified timely based on changes in performance indexes.
